> Among others: 
>  * move variable declaration closer to the place it is set
> and used,
>    if possible,
>  * uniquify and simplify coding style a bit, which includes
> removing
>    unnecessary '()'.
>  * check type only if $hash was defined, as otherwise from
> the way
>    git_get_hash_by_path() is called (and works), we know
> that it is
>    a blob,
>  * use modern calling convention for git-blame,
>  * remove unused variable,
>  * don't use implicit variables ($_),
>  * add some comments
> 
> Signed-off-by: Jakub Narebski <jnareb@gmail.com>
Acked-by: Luben Tuikov <ltuikov@yahoo.com>

Looks good.
